Share your stories of businesses helping communities during the Covid-19 crisis

Cooking school, Made In Hackney, has organised free food deliveries to vulnerable people in London.
Cooking school, Made In Hackney, has organised free food deliveries to vulnerable people in London. Photograph: James Perrin/Rex/Shutterstock

The coronavirus pandemic has brought out the best and the worst in society. While headlines have focused on stripped supermarkets, some companies have been quietly helping out local communities, despite facing ruin. We want to hear of those heroes, big or small, who have found creative ways to offer support and cheer.
